Houston has two Airports. IAH is north of town and HOU is south of town. The city is also serviced by two cruise terminals. One is The Port of Houston which is located on Upper Galveston Bay. The other is the Port of Galveston which is on Galveston island.

 

Many hotels in the vicinity of the airports offer airport shuttles but none will offer cruise pier shuttles. Some hotels in Galveston will offer shuttles to the pier but not the airports. I am unaware of any hotels near the Port of Houston that offer shuttles to the pier, perhaps someone else does. I doubt any of these hotels will have airport shuttles though.
